WitrynaLow-glycemic foods have a rating of 55 or less, and foods rated 70-100 are considered high-glycemic foods. Medium-level foods have a glycemic index of 56-69. Witryna16 cze 2024 · The fiber count is a whopping 16.4 grams if the eggplant is unpeeled. 1 cup of cubed eggplant (without fat) has 20.5 calories, 0.148 grams of fat and 4.82 grams of carbs, and 2.46 grams of fiber. Additionally, eggplant is rich in antioxidants which can help to reduce inflammation and fight off disease. 3  It's a good source of potassium. Witryna22 mar 2024 · Low GI: 55 or less. Medium GI: 56 to 69. High GI: 70 to 100. The following charts highlight low, medium, and high GI foods based on data from the American Diabetes Association. 3. Low-GI Foods (55 or Less) Foods. GI.
